excel公式中怎么锁定一个数值不变公式显示
作者:百问excel教程网
|
372人看过
发布时间:2026-03-10 15:46:07
在Excel中,若想锁定公式中的特定数值,使其在复制或填充公式时保持不变,核心方法是使用“绝对引用”,即通过在被引用的单元格行号与列标前添加美元符号来实现。这能有效解答用户关于“excel公式中怎么锁定一个数值不变公式显示”的核心困惑,确保计算基准固定。掌握此技巧是提升数据处理效率与准确性的关键一步。
在日常使用表格软件处理数据时,我们常常会遇到一个非常实际的问题:设计好一个计算公式后,当我们需要将这个公式应用到其他行或列时,公式里引用的某些单元格却会跟着一起变动,而这并非我们的本意。比如,你可能用一个单元格存放着固定的税率、单价或者某个关键的换算系数,你希望这个值在所有相关的计算中都保持不变。这时,一个自然而然的疑问就产生了:excel公式中怎么锁定一个数值不变公式显示?这不仅仅是关于一个符号的添加,更关乎对表格软件引用机制的理解与应用。
要透彻理解并解决这个问题,我们首先需要明白表格软件中公式引用的基本规则。当你输入“=A1+B1”这样的公式时,你使用的是“相对引用”。这意味着,如果你将这个公式从C1单元格向下拖动填充到C2单元格,公式会自动变为“=A2+B2”。软件的逻辑是:新的公式相对于它原来的位置发生了同样的位移。这种设计在大多数需要按行或列进行规律性计算的场景下非常高效,比如计算每一行的合计。但当我们遇到需要固定参照某个特定单元格,例如一个存放着固定折扣率的单元格D1时,相对引用就会带来麻烦。复制公式后,对D1的引用会变成D2、D3……而D2、D3很可能没有数据或数据不对,导致计算结果全部错误。 因此,为了解决“锁定一个数值”的需求,我们必须引入“绝对引用”的概念。绝对引用的操作方法非常简单:在你希望锁定的单元格地址的行号和列标前面,加上美元符号。例如,如果你希望无论公式复制到哪里,都始终引用D1单元格里的折扣率,你就应该把公式中的“D1”写成“$D$1”。这里的美元符号就像一个“锁”,$锁定了列(D),$锁定了行(1)。当你把包含“=$A$1B1”的公式从C1拖到C2时,公式会变为“=$A$1B2”。你会发现,对A1的引用纹丝不动,而对B1的引用则随着行变化了。这正是实现“锁定一个数值不变”的核心秘诀。 除了完全锁定行和列的“绝对引用”,还有一种更灵活的方式,称为“混合引用”。这种引用方式只锁定行或只锁定列,而不是两者都锁定。具体来说,“$A1”表示锁定了A列,但行号可以相对变化;“A$1”则表示锁定了第1行,但列标可以相对变化。混合引用在处理某些特定结构的表格时极为有用。例如,在制作一个乘法表时,顶行(第一行)是乘数,最左列(第一列)是被乘数。在B2单元格输入公式“=$A2B$1”后,向右向下拖动填充,就能快速生成完整的九九乘法表。这里,$A确保了公式向右复制时始终引用第一列的被乘数,B$1确保了公式向下复制时始终引用第一行的乘数。理解并善用混合引用,能让你的公式设计更加精巧和高效。 在实际操作中,有一个非常便捷的技巧可以快速切换引用类型,而不必手动输入美元符号。当你在编辑栏中点击或选中公式中的某个单元格引用(如A1)后,反复按键盘上的F4功能键,你会发现这个引用的形式会在“A1”(相对引用)、“$A$1”(绝对引用)、“A$1”(混合引用,锁定行)、“$A1”(混合引用,锁定列)这四种状态之间循环切换。你可以根据当前的需要,快速切换到合适的引用类型,这大大提升了编辑公式的效率。 让我们通过几个具体的场景来加深理解。第一个典型场景是固定比率计算。假设你在处理一份销售报表,D1单元格存放着一个统一的增值税率(比如13%)。你需要在E列计算每一行销售额(C列)的税额。那么,在E2单元格中,你应该输入的公式是“=C2$D$1”。当你将这个公式向下填充至E3、E4……时,公式会依次变为“=C3$D$1”、“=C4$D$1”。这样,每一行的计算都准确无误地使用了D1单元格的固定税率。 第二个常见场景是查询基准固定。比如你有一份员工信息表,在另一个区域你需要根据一个固定的工号(假设存放在H1单元格)来查询该员工的所有信息。使用VLOOKUP函数时,你的查找值参数就应该设置为“$H$1”,以确保无论公式复制到哪里,查找的对象始终是H1单元格里指定的那个工号。公式可能类似“=VLOOKUP($H$1, A:F, 2, FALSE)”。 第三个场景涉及跨表引用。当你的公式需要引用其他工作表甚至其他工作簿中的某个固定单元格时,使用绝对引用就更为重要。例如,公式“=SUM(Sheet2!$B$2:$B$10)”表示对Sheet2工作表中B2到B10这个固定区域进行求和。即使你在当前工作表的不同位置复制这个公式,求和的区域也不会改变,保证了数据汇总的一致性。 理解引用类型,对于使用名称管理器也很有帮助。你可以为一个固定的单元格或区域定义一个名称,例如将$D$1定义为“税率”。之后在公式中直接使用“=C2税率”,其效果与使用“=$D$1”完全一致,而且公式的可读性大大增强。名称本身默认就是绝对引用,这是一个非常优雅的“锁定”数值的方法。 在数组公式或动态数组函数流行的今天,绝对引用的概念依然至关重要。例如,在使用SORT或FILTER等函数时,如果引用的排序依据列或筛选条件区域需要固定,同样需要使用绝对引用。它确保了当你的公式溢出到其他单元格时,计算的逻辑基础不会发生偏移。 许多用户在尝试锁定数值时,会遇到一个困惑:为什么我锁定了单元格,但复制公式后结果还是变了?这通常有几个原因。第一,可能锁错了对象。你需要确认美元符号加在了真正需要固定的那个单元格地址上。第二,公式中可能还有其他未锁定的相对引用部分在变化,影响了最终结果。第三,也是最容易忽略的一点,被引用的“固定”单元格本身的值可能被其他公式或操作意外更改了。绝对引用只能防止引用地址变化,不能防止单元格内容被修改。 为了更彻底地“锁定”,除了使用绝对引用,你还可以考虑将那个作为常数的单元格的值“硬编码”到公式中。例如,直接将税率13%写入公式“=C20.13”。这样做虽然完全固定了数值,但也失去了灵活性。一旦税率需要调整,你必须手动修改每一个相关公式,极易出错且效率低下。因此,将常数存放在一个单独的单元格并用绝对引用,是更专业和可维护的做法。 在处理大型复杂模型时,规划好哪些单元格或区域需要作为绝对引用的“锚点”,是模型结构清晰、运行正确的保障。通常,模型的假设参数、关键常数、汇总表头等,都应该被设置为绝对引用。这就像建筑中的承重墙,它们的位置必须固定不变。 最后,让我们再审视一下“excel公式中怎么锁定一个数值不变公式显示”这个问题的本质。它反映的是用户对数据计算确定性和可控性的追求。掌握绝对引用和混合引用,不仅仅是学会按F4键或输入$符号,更是建立起一种思维:在让软件自动化处理的同时,精确地告诉它哪些是必须遵守的固定规则,哪些是可以灵活变动的部分。这种对引用关系的掌控能力,是区分普通使用者和进阶用户的重要标志。 希望以上从原理、操作、技巧到场景的详细阐述,能帮助你彻底解决公式中数值锁定的问题。记住,当你下次再需要固定某个值时,先明确它是需要完全固定($A$1),还是只需要固定行(A$1)或列($A1),然后熟练地运用F4键或手动添加美元符号。随着实践的增加,你会越来越得心应手,设计出的表格也会更加稳健和高效。表格软件的魅力,就在于通过这样一个个精巧的设定,将复杂的计算逻辑封装在简洁的公式之中,而理解引用,正是打开这扇大门的第一把钥匙。
推荐文章
在电子表格软件中,若需在公式复制时锁定特定单元格的引用使其不随位置改变,核心方法是使用绝对引用,即在单元格地址的行号与列标前添加美元符号。本文将深入剖析这一需求,并提供从基础概念到高级应用场景的详尽指南,帮助您彻底掌握excel公式中如何固定选中其中的一个数据不变化的技巧与精髓。
2026-03-10 15:44:55
245人看过
要固定Excel(微软表格软件)公式不被修改,核心在于综合运用工作表与单元格保护、公式隐藏、工作簿结构锁定以及文件权限控制等多层防护策略,从而确保关键计算逻辑的完整性与数据安全性。理解如何固定excel公式不被修改数据的正确方法,能有效防止误操作或未经授权的变动,是提升表格管理效率的关键步骤。
2026-03-10 15:43:20
79人看过
在Excel中,若要计算两个日期之间相隔的月份数,核心方法是使用DATEDIF函数,其公式基本结构为=DATEDIF(开始日期, 结束日期, “M”),这能直接返回整月差值,是解决“两个日期计算月份 excel公式是什么”这一问题最直接有效的方案。
2026-03-10 14:59:12
96人看过
在Excel中,加减符号的显示并非直接输入,而是通过运算符和特定函数来实现计算,本文将详细解析如何在公式中正确使用加减符号,涵盖基础操作、显示异常处理、高级应用及实用技巧,帮助用户彻底掌握这一核心功能。
2026-03-10 14:58:51
111人看过
.webp)
.webp)
.webp)
.webp)